P1480 Open Or Shorted Condition Detected In The Positive Crankcase Ventilation

P1480 is a diagnostic trouble code (DTC) that indicates an issue with the positive crankcase ventilation (PCV) system. It means that either an open or shorted condition has been detected in the PCV system. The PCV system is responsible for controlling and regulating the pressure inside of the engine’s crankcase, thus ensuring proper air-fuel mixture and preventing oil leaks from occurring.

P1480 is a Trouble Code Indicating That an Open Or Shorted Condition Has Been Detected in the Positive Crankcase Ventilation (Pcv) System of Your Vehicle

If you’ve been driving your car and have seen the trouble code P1480 appear on your dashboard, you may be wondering what this means. This code indicates that an open or shorted condition has been detected in the Positive Crankcase Ventilation (PCV) system of your vehicle.

The PCV system is a part of your engine’s emissions control system that helps reduce pollutants produced by combusting fuel within the engine cylinders.

The PCV valve works to draw out any unburned gasoline vapors from within the crankcase and sends them back into the air intake where they can then be passed through the combustion process again. As such, it plays an important role in keeping emissions low while maintaining optimal performance levels for your vehicle.

P1480 is caused when there is an issue with either one or all components of this PCV system; either something has become blocked or disconnected, or one of its parts has already become damaged beyond repair due to age and wear and tear over time.
